  • Content-aware fill and layers

    One thing I'd been wondering about very eagerly is whether the content-aware fill feature(s) would source their content from multiple layers, or only from the current layer, or whether there might be an option, as for the clone stamp tool for example, to choose whether the current layer, the current layer and below, or all layers were sampled for content.
    I hadn't noticed any demonstration of content-aware fill on a document having multiple pixel layers.
    Here are the results from my testing. (They may be wrong!)
    What I want to be able to do, is to put a single "corrections" layer at the top of a layer stack, and to make local corrections using content from all layers below—with the latter being rasterized on the fly as necessary, so that the cumulative effect of masks, layer effects, blending modes, transparency, knockout, adjustment layers and anything else, are all used as content for the corrections. Until now I've done something similar but more limited with the clone stamp tool. Content awareness seemed to offer greater promise, for three reasons. (1) No back and forth: no choosing and monitoring of source pixels. (2) No visible softening of the correction at the edge of the brush. (3) The promise of imperceptible results with very little thought or work.
    So, can we do this?
    For fill, content-awareness only extends to pixels in the current layer. It doesn't look below. If the current layer is empty, then Photoshop comes back with a message that filling is not possible in content-aware mode, because not enough content can be found. If the current layer is blank (e.g. all white), then you just get more blank. That's fair enough. You could use content-aware fill early, on source layers, or late and destructively, after flattening. But not what I'm looking for.
    The same is not true of the spot healing brush, which has both a "content aware" option and a "sample all layers option". And it works wonders. It does exactly what I want. Empty layer, sample all layers, run the the brush over dodgy parts of the image, and hey presto—it really does feel as if you have a wand in your hand.

  • Photoshop CS5 content-aware scale

    Hi, I'm a photoshop CS5.1 64 bits user, I'm following the "Learn adobe photoshop CS5 by video" with the instructor  Kelly McCathran. Well, I need to know how to create two layers with different sizes to apply content-aware scale...I can't! I import a picture (4000x3000) from adobe bridge...When I create a layer with a different dimension (3000x2000) the picture (4000x3000) turns to (3000x2000)!!! What am I supposed to do?

    With the smaller image appearing with the larger one in Photoshop, click on the smaller image in its Layers panel and drag it over the larger image.
    Once the smaller image is sitting on top of the larger one in the Layers panel, you can change the size of the smaller image by using Edit > Transform > Scale.
    Hold down the Shift key as you alter the scale, the image maintains proportion.

  • Content Aware Scaling and not enough RAM

    I'm on a mac book pro that i bought october 2008 with 4 Gb RAM, with a 2.8 GHz Intel core 2 duo processor. I run content aware scaling on a file make my adjustments, click return and get the warning dialogue: “Could not complete your request because there is not enough memory (RAM).”
    In earlier adobe forums people have talked about CAScaling not working well with Bigger tiles plug in activated. as far as I can see I do not even have that plug in. I go to apps>PS CS4 >plug-ins > extentions -- and it's not there -- I see plug ins for AltiVecCore, Enable Async IO, FastCore MMXCore, Multi Processor Support. PPCCore, and scripting support -- but not a Bigger tiles plug in which I still have in my previous copy of CS3 -- but not CS4.
    So I'm wondering what's up - how to solve this issue and get back to work -- and just how I should have my PS performance preferences set up for best performance. Anyone out there with a clue?
    thanks,
    owen

    I think I discovered the source of my problem -- doing too many things at once -- I did however , as you suggested, Buko, allot 90% of my RAM to photoshop. My image was a panorama made from seven RAW files shot with my Canon G-10 -- about 15 inches by 63 inches @ 240 ppi. I first stitched them together out of Lightroom -- no problem. But of course the edges were rounded, and I wanted to stretch my sky and foreground to fill the image rectangle without any apparent distortion. I figured CAS was perfect for this... and so it is,  once I figured things out.
    It is now my intent to stitch the pano every way possible in CS4 and see which one looks best in this particular instance. I may have multiple favorite methodologies, and discover which procedure fits what kind of situation best. My problem, I think, was that in applying the CA scaling transformation, I pulled on all four sides of the image - not just one. But PS and CAS worked just fine if I transformed each edge or side separately. Perhaps it works fine pulling and transforming on all sides if I'm on an 8 core mac pro tower with 16 gigs of RAM -- we'll see -- but for now -- I'll try it separately with each edge @ 100% RAM allowance -- to see if that had anything to do with my problem -- otherwise I'll keep it in the optimum range, and transform one side at a time.
